Resident Fee Rates

This table contains data on resident fee rates for the Massachusetts public higher education institutions. It does not include data on tuition.

Resident Fee Rates, Massachusetts Public Higher Education, 1999–2009

Community Colleges
Berkshire Community College $1650 $1710 $1920 $2310 $2610 $2610 $2820 $2896 $3046 $3150
Bristol Community College $1260 $1350 $1440 $2100 $2340 $2520 $3030 $3030 $3030 $3120
Bunker Hill Community College $1230 $1230 $1230 $1680 $2280 $2280 $2350 $2280 $2460 $2760
Cape Cod Community College $1440 $1590 $1740 $2460 $2460 $2940 $2940 $2940 $3226 $3360
Greenfield Community College $1367 $1517 $1727 $2237 $2537 $2867 $3202 $3318 $3708 $3858
Holyoke Community College $1366 $1456 $1716 $2076 $2376 $2378 $2468 $2558 $2708 $2838
MassBay Community College $1170 $1170 $1240 $2150 $2450 $2930 $2930 $2930 $2930 $3890
Massasoit Community College $1230 $1320 $1320 $1920 $2610 $2610 $2610 $2610 $2610 $2790
Middlesex Community College $1550 $1640 $1790 $2300 $2660 $2930 $2930 $3020 $3140 $3290
Mount Wachusett Community College $1790 $1820 $1940 $2660 $3260 $3260 $3220 $3370 $3670 $3790
North Shore Community College $1320 $1440 $1740 $2340 $2640 $2640 $2730 $2730 $2880 $3000
Northern Essex Community College $1380 $1440 $1530 $1920 $2220 $2220 $2400 $2310 $2580 $2760
Quinsigamond Community College $1170 $1170 $1170 $2010 $2880 $2880 $2880 $3030 $3150 $3240
Roxbury Community College $1230 $1320 $1320 $1670 $2470 $2680 $2680 $2680 $2880 $2970
Springfield Technical Community College $1430 $1434 $1684 $1984 $2394 $2454 $2604 $2706 $2826 $2946
Community Colleges Average* $1353 $1418 $1539 $2099 $2532 $2646 $2749 $2785 $2920 $3118
State Colleges
Bridgewater State College $2033 $1913 $1913 $2825 $3480 $4416 $4596 $4956 $5124 $5328
Fitchburg State College $1928 $1988 $2018 $2718 $3216 $3618 $4032 $4572 $5022 $5430
Framingham State College $1800 $1800 $1800 $2364 $3354 $3684 $4034 $4480 $4828 $5172
Massachusetts College of Art and Design $2668 $2788 $3038 $3938 $4738 $5370 $5820 $6170 $6420 $6870
Massachusetts College of Liberal Arts $2267 $2267 $2467 $3167 $4367 $4387 $4586 $4896 $5138 $5396
Massachusetts Maritime Academy $1784 $1783 $1883 $2633 $3833 $4133 $4446 $4580 $4548 $4644
Salem State College $1928 $2128 $2128 $3028 $4078 $4544 $4684 $5120 $5360 $5610
Westfield State College $1884 $1886 $1986 $2785 $3588 $3887 $4688 $4980 $5240 $5482
Worcester State College $1368 $1478 $1603 $2303 $3153 $3609 $4110 $4570 $4896 $5200
State Colleges Average* $1913 $1947 $1999 $2789 $3637 $4147 $4502 $4900 $5166 $5441
University of Massachusetts campuses
University of Massachusetts Amherst $3498 $3498 $3498 $4768 $5768 $7294 $7566 $7886 $8210 $8520
University of Massachusetts Boston $2508 $2508 $2508 $3508 $4518 $6310 $6554 $6834 $7126 $7400
University of Massachusetts Dartmouth $2712 $2712 $2712 $3712 $4712 $6385 $6622 $6894 $7178 $7444
University of Massachusetts Lowell $2801 $2801 $2801 $3759 $4760 $6437 $6712 $6990 $7278 $7552
University of Massachusetts Average* $3077 $3072 $3069 $4179 $5184 $6819 $7081 $7382 $7687 $7966
Note: Rates represent average for a resident of Massachusetts taking undergraduate, state-supported courses on a full-time basis. Fees do not include scheduled increase of $750 effective in spring 2004 per campus at the University of Massachusetts.
*Weighted averages calculated based on % Undergraduate FTE (Full-Time Equivalent) of total by segment and overall.
